Quantum Walking to Fitness tells you how to become more fit and healthy by working short walks into your daily life. Quantum Walking is simple, engaging exercise that you will always be able to do. This short book tells you how to determine your own personal quantum, how to count your walks, and even how to “act,” when you don’t want your coworkers to know that you are exercising.

The “quantum walk” is the shortest walk that can help you improve your physical fitness. By combining many quantum walks to reach your daily goal, you can enjoy better health. This book, with a light touch, delves into the many details of planning, taking, and counting short walks. It’s not necessary to set aside a big chunk of time for this physical activity, because the book explains how to work them into your daily activities.
